Plot

The movie centers on the love story of two college-going students Aadi and Priya. Aadi is a lively and happy soul. He is poor in his studies and spends most of his time playing games with his friends. While on the other hand, Priya is a sincere student who visits temples every day and is concerned about her studies. Aadi meets his junior Priya and falls in love at first sight. He then impressed her and eventually, both became a couple. However, they started to drift apart from each other as Priya couldn’t accept the immature and irresponsible behavior of Aadi and hence they decided to take a break from their relationship. What will happen to their relationship after the break? Will this break successfully bring a change to Aadi’s demeanor? The story explores the answers to these questions.

Star Performances

The cast of this film consists mainly of Newcomers and debutants; hence, nothing much was to be expected from them. Their performances highlight their amateur nature. Tarun did a decent job with his character in this film, although at some pivotal parts of the film, his performance fails to generate the desired results. Avantika did a pleasant work as “Priya”. Her efforts were visible in her performance. But she overdid in some of the scenes in the film. Kireeti stole the show with his excellent comic timing and brilliant portrayal. He acts as a catalyst for the film. Jenny and Swaraj did a fine job. The rest of the cast supported the story of the film with their performances. 

Analysis

‘Meeku Meere Maaku Meeme” is a Telugu romantic drama film directed by Hussain Sha Kiran. He tries to showcase a romantic love story with a modern touch to it while exploring the complexities of nowadays relationships. The themes of love, friendship, adulting, self-discovery, and sacrifice are significantly used in this film. The movie attempts to explore contemporary relationships through the love story of two college-going students Aadi and Priya. However, rather than trying out something different and unique, the film delivers a mundane love story. It stays on the surface and fails to explore the in-depth difficulties and complexities of modern-day relationships. The screenplay of this movie amalgamates humor and drama into a love story. It works at times but fails to maintain the momentum. This results in a disoriented narrative. The overall cinematography of this movie effectively captures the aesthetic and vibrant visuals and enhances the mood of the scenes; however, at times it feels inconsistent with the main story. The movie struggles to tackle the pacing issues. The editing of the film feels sloppy and disruptive many times. Also, some of the scenes felt unnecessary and could have been removed from the final product. The music of the film did its part. It enhances the movie-watching experience of the viewers. The background score of this film also heightens the impact of the scenes. When we talk about the performances in this film, the cast did a fine job with their characters. The chemistry between the leading actors enhances the on-screen love angle between their characters. Keerti’s performance is the highlight of this movie. It’s a treat to watch him performing comedy on-screen. The pacing issues of the movie interfere with the audience's connection with the movie’s story. The predictable climax fails to deliver to the audience’s expectations.

Verdict

‘Meeku Meere Maaku Meeme’ is a romantic drama film with a pinch of comedy in it. It tries to explore the struggles and difficulties of the present generation and how they deal with their everyday life. It successfully captures the essence of friendship and love but fails to sustain the same till the end of the film. Despite all its flaws, it remains a decent story for those who are looking for a light-hearted and humorous take on nowadays relationships and friendships.
